Dental Marketing With AI: How to Build a Real Content Workflow

Dr Marketing Inc • June 15, 2026

Source: Dr. Marketing



Most dental practices know content matters. Blogs support SEO, social media builds familiarity, and educational pages help patients feel more confident before booking. The issue is not motivation. The issue is consistency. 


In many dental practices, content gets created only when someone has spare time. A blog is published when rankings slip. A post goes live when the front desk has a quiet moment. Even when the content is decent, it is usually disconnected and irregular, which makes SEO growth harder than it needs to be. 


AI can help, but only if you use it as part of a workflow. AI is not a strategy, and it is not a replacement for dental expertise. What it can do is speed up the slowest parts of content creation, so your practice can publish useful, search-friendly content consistently without burning out staff. 


This guide walks through a realistic, repeatable content creation workflow for a dental practice using AI, including planning, outlining, drafting, SEO cleanup, repurposing, and ongoing improvement. 

 



Why Dental Practices Need a Workflow (Not Just “More Content”) 



A dental practice that publishes one blog about teeth whitening, then nothing for two months, then a post about Invisalign, then a holiday graphic is not building authority. Search engines reward topical depth and consistency. Patients also trust dental practices that explain things clearly and show up regularly. A workflow creates structure, so content is not dependent on spare time. It turns content from a stressful task into a repeatable system. 


A strong workflow helps your dental practice: 


  • Create content that supports priority services like dental implants, emergency dentistry, crowns, Invisalign, and teeth whitening, so your marketing effort ties directly to what you want to grow. 
  • Reduce decision fatigue by using a repeatable calendar, so you are not reinventing topics and formats every month. 
  • Improve SEO by building topic clusters that strengthen service pages through internal links and related supporting content. 
  • Maintain consistent messaging across your website, blog, social media, and email, which makes your dental practice sound more credible and cohesive. 
  • Repurpose each blog into multiple supporting pieces so one strong article fuels weeks of marketing without extra writing. 


Once this structure is in place, AI becomes genuinely useful because it supports a system instead of generating random output. 

 



Step 1: Choose the Services Your Dental Practice Wants to Rank For



Before you use AI, decide what content you should focus on. Most dental practices get the best results when they start with three to five priority services that are both high-value and commonly searched, such as dental implants, emergency dentistry, Invisalign, teeth whitening, dentures, root canals, crowns, or veneers. 


This step matters because AI can generate endless content ideas, but without priorities, your dental practice will publish content that does not support your revenue goals or your SEO goals. A service-first approach helps you: 


  • Focus on content that attracts the right patients, not just traffic. 
  • Build a clear website structure where supporting blogs link back to service pages. 
  • Create depth around a few key services instead of spreading content too thin. 


Once your priority services are clear, you can build a content system that compounds. 

 



Step 2: Use AI to Build Topic Clusters Around Each Service 




One of the fastest ways to improve dental SEO is to create topic clusters. This means you do not write one blog per service and stop. You create multiple supporting articles that answer different questions people search for around that service. 


AI makes this faster by generating topic angles and common questions quickly. Your practice still chooses the best topics, but you do not start from zero. For example, if your dental practice wants to grow dental implant traffic, a topic cluster might include: 


  • A patient-friendly explanation of how dental implants work, including what the implant post does, how the crown fits, and why implants differ from bridges or dentures. 
  • A detailed guide to dental implant cost factors that explains why prices vary, what influences treatment plans, and what patients should ask during a consultation. 
  • A realistic recovery timeline article that explains healing stages, what is normal after surgery, and when patients can return to everyday routines. 
  • A comparison article that explains implants vs bridges vs dentures in practical terms, focusing on function, maintenance, and long-term durability. 
  • A candidacy-focused article that explains bone loss, whether bone grafting may be needed, and what options exist if implants are not suitable. 


This approach improves SEO because you are building depth and showing expertise across multiple search intents, not just repeating the same service summary.

Step 3: Outline First (This Is Where AI Helps the Most)



If you want AI content that does not feel generic, outlining is non-negotiable. Asking AI to write a full blog immediately often leads to shallow content that repeats itself. Instead, use AI to generate a detailed outline that matches search intent. Search intent is the reason someone is searching. Are they comparing options, worried about pain, looking for cost information, or trying to understand a procedure? 


A strong outline should include: 


  • An intro that addresses the real patient question, not a vague definition. 
  • Clear headings that expand the topic logically instead of circling the same point. 
  • A “what to expect” section because patients search for timelines, steps, and outcomes. 
  • A section that addresses common questions or misunderstandings. 
  • A conclusion that naturally guides next steps, such as booking a consult. 


For example, a teeth whitening blog should cover why teeth stain, why strips sometimes fail, what results are realistic, how long whitening lasts, what to avoid after whitening, and when whitening is not recommended. This outline step is what makes the final blog feel informative and content-heavy. 

 



Step 4: Draft With AI, Then Apply a Simple Review Process 



Once the outline is approved, AI can draft the blog quickly. This is where dental practices save time. But dental practices should not publish AI drafts without review. Dental topics sit close to healthcare, so accuracy and responsible wording matter.  A clean review workflow keeps quality high without making content creation slow. 


A practical review process looks like this: 


  • A medical reviewer confirms accuracy, including timelines, procedure descriptions, candidacy notes, and what your dental practice actually offers. This can be quick if the outline is strong. 
  • A marketing editor improves clarity and flow, tightens repetitive sections, and ensures the main keyword appears naturally in key places like the title, headings, intro, and conclusion. 
  • A final polish pass removes awkward AI phrasing and ensures the tone sounds like a real dental practice speaking to real patients. 


This keeps your content trustworthy and prevents the “generic dental blog” feel that does not convert.

Step 5: Strengthen SEO Without Keyword Stuffing 



SEO is not about repeating the keyword again. It is about covering the topic thoroughly and using related dental language naturally. AI can help improve this by suggesting related terms and improving headings and subheadings. 


For example, a dental implant blog should naturally include related terms like implant crown, bone loss, healing stages, and alternatives like bridges or dentures where relevant.  AI can also help you add internal links, which is one of the easiest SEO wins for dental sites. A blog about dental implants should link to the implant service page and, when applicable, related pages like dentures, crowns, or bone grafting. To keep SEO clean and readable, your content should: 


  • Use the main keyword in the title and early in the intro. 
  • Use related keywords naturally in headings and explanations. 
  • Include internal links that help readers and strengthen site structure. 
  • Avoid filler paragraphs that do not add new information. 


When the content is genuinely useful, SEO becomes easier. 

 



Step 6: Repurpose One Blog Into Weeks of Content 



Most dental practices waste content by publishing it once and moving on. AI makes repurposing fast, which helps dental practices stay consistent without constantly writing. 


A single dental blog can become multiple supporting pieces across platforms. This is how you get more ROI from every article. A good repurposing workflow includes: 


  • Social posts that highlight one takeaway at a time, such as a common misconception, a quick tip, or a “what to expect” point pulled from the blog. 
  • Website FAQ content that can be added to service pages to support SEO and reduce patient hesitation before booking. 
  • Email newsletter snippets that summarize the blog and drive traffic back to your website. 
  • Google Business Profile posts that reinforce local relevance and keep your listing active. 


This step turns one strong blog into a full month of supporting content without adding extra writing time.

Step 7: Make the Workflow Repeatable Each Month



The most important part of this system is that it can be repeated. Your dental practice does not need a complicated process. It needs a realistic one. 


A sustainable monthly workflow often looks like: choose topics, outline, draft, review, optimize, repurpose, schedule. AI reduces the time required at every stage, so the dental practice can keep publishing without relying on last-minute effort. 


Consistency is what drives SEO growth. A dental practice that publishes one strong blog every month and supports it with repurposed content will usually outperform a dental practice that publishes sporadically, even if the sporadic content is good. 

 



Step 8: Improve Over Time Using Real Performance Data 




AI workflows improve when you use feedback. Track which blogs bring traffic, which topics generate calls, and which pages are climbing in rankings. Then use those insights to guide your next topics. 


AI can help summarize what is happening and suggest next steps, but the strategy is still human-led. The goal is to build a feedback loop where your content gets more targeted and more effective over time.
